Centro Storico suits travelers who want iconic sights outside their door. Around Piazza del Duomo and Via dei Calzaiuoli you step out to the cathedral, the Uffizi, and the Arno in minutes, which is ideal for short stays or tight sightseeing schedules. It is busier and more expensive, especially near Piazza della Signoria and Via Tornabuoni. Oltrarno, across Ponte Vecchio and Ponte Santa Trinita, works better for travelers who care more about atmosphere than ticking off museums. Streets like Via Romana and Borgo San Frediano stay lively at night with trattorie, wine bars, and artisan studios, yet rooms are usually quieter and better value. Summer peaks in June, July, and August, often hitting 30\u00b0C or higher, with heavy crowds and fully booked central hotels. The Scoppio del Carro, a traditional Easter Sunday event in Piazza del Duomo, draws large springtime audiences and pushes rates up near the historic center. By contrast, November is quieter and cooler, around 8\u00b0C to 15\u00b0C, and hotel prices can drop 30 to 40 percent compared with peak summer season.<\/p>\n<h2>Getting to Florence from the Airport<\/h2>\n<table class=\"travorio-fare-table\">\n<caption>Airport Transfer<\/caption>\n<tr>\n<td>Airport<\/td>\n<td>FLR<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Distance<\/td>\n<td>5 km from city center<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Transfer Options<\/td>\n<td>Tram T2 20 min or taxi \u20ac20<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<\/table>\n<p>From Florence Airport (FLR) to the city center, the fastest option is a taxi, taking about 15 minutes and usually costing \u20ac22\u2013\u20ac25 including the airport surcharge. The cheapest option is the T2 tram line to \u201cUnit\u00e0\u201d or \u201cAlamanni-Stazione\u201d near Santa Maria Novella, taking around 20 minutes for \u20ac1.70. Buy tram tickets at machines before boarding and validate them on the tram. In 2 days you can see the Duomo complex, Michelangelo\u2019s David at Galleria dell\u2019Accademia, and the Uffizi Gallery. With longer, add Oltrarno artisan workshops and sunset at Piazzale Michelangelo. Sample itinerary: Day 1: Duomo, Baptistery, climb Brunelleschi\u2019s dome, evening around Piazza della Signoria. Day 2: Uffizi in the morning, Ponte Vecchio, Pitti Palace and Boboli Gardens. Day 3: Accademia for David, Santa Croce, then aperitivo in Santo Spirito. A sit down meal at a mid range restaurant typically runs about $20 to $25 per person, excluding wine. A 24 hour public transport pass costs around $6 and covers buses and trams across the city. Entry to the Uffizi Gallery, one of Florence\u2019s key attractions, is about $25. Hotels span a wide range, from simple guesthouses at roughly $50 per night to luxury properties around $450. Compared with London or New York, Florence feels slightly cheaper day to day. Oltrarno works better if you prefer a more local atmosphere, artisan workshops, and quieter streets near Palazzo Pitti and the Boboli Gardens. Santa Croce offers good mid range options and a strong nightlife scene, with easy access to the river and slightly fewer crowds than the central core. San Lorenzo and San Marco put you close to the markets and the Accademia Gallery, with many budget and mid range hotels within a 10 to 15 minute walk of the main sights.<\/div>\n<\/p>\n<\/div>\n<\/div>\n<div itemprop=\"mainEntity\" itemscope itemtype=\"https:\/\/schema.org\/Question\">\n<h3 itemprop=\"name\">How much do hotels in Florence typically cost per night on Travorio?<\/h3>\n<div itemprop=\"acceptedAnswer\" itemscope itemtype=\"https:\/\/schema.org\/Answer\">\n<div itemprop=\"text\">On Travorio, you can usually find basic guesthouses and simple two star stays from around 50 to 90 US dollars per night, especially outside peak dates.
